Solutions to the Einstein-Maxwell-Current System with Sasakian maifolds

Published 4 Dec 2020 in gr-qc and math.DG | (2012.02432v1)

Abstract: We construct stationary solutions to the Einstein-Maxwell-current system by using the Sasakian manifold for the three-dimensional space. Both the magnetic field and the electric current in the solution are specified by the contact form of the Sasakian manifold. The solutions contain an arbitrary function that describes inhomogeneity of the number density of the charged particles, and the function determines the curvature of the space.
